Teaching Channel Talks Episode 80: Heart-Centered Approaches to Teaching and Learning (w/Regyna Curtis & Dr. Adrienne MacIain)

By taking a heart-centered approach to teaching and embracing intuition as a part of learning, we can become better educators and help our students think outside of the box. Join Dr. Wendy Amato, Dr. Adrienne MacIain, and Regyna Curtis as they talk about how we can make subtle changes in our teaching approach to help boost the creativity of ourselves and our learners. From defining creative leadership to addressing the dangers of “creativity killers” this inspiring discussion will leave you with actionable ways to encourage your students with clarity and confidence.

Our Guests

Regyna Curtis is an artist and soul mentor with a formal education background and decades of experience living as an intuitive being. She is an expert in interpreting soul wisdom languages and uses this to support and empower individuals, especially teachers and entrepreneurs, in finding the confidence and clarity to live their most authentic lives. You can connect with Regyna on social media (@Atmaitri) and learn more about soul wisdom by visiting her website.

Dr. Adrienne MacIain is a coach, inspirational speaker, and the bestselling author of the Creative Flow for All series, She helps individuals unleash the power of Creative Flow and realign to their natural creative rhythms so they can continuously innovate and build their authentic authority. Dr. MacIain holds a Ph.D. in Theater from UC Santa Barbara. Connect with Adrienne on social media (@magicwants) and learn more about her work on her website.

Our Host

Dr. Wendy Amato is the Chief Academic Officer at Teaching Channel’s parent company, K12 Coalition. Wendy earned her Master’s in Education and Ph.D. in Curriculum and Instruction from the University of Virginia. She holds an MBA from James Madison University. Wendy began teaching in 1991, has served as a Middle School Administrator, and still teaches at UVA’s School of Education. She has delivered teacher professional development workshops and student leadership workshops in the US and internationally. Wendy and her family live near Charlottesville, Virginia.
